PENN QUARTER—Starting tomorrow, The Source is unleashing a family-style menu modeled after a Chinese banquet. The weekly rotating menu is priced at $65 per person and includes things like angry soft shell crabs. It'll be available for dinner service through September 3. [EaterWire]

ATLAS DISTRICT—Frozen Tropics reports that the Red Palace — otherwise known as the newly merged Palace of Wonders and Red and the Black — has opened its patio for business. [FT]

CHARITYWIRE—If you like kids, summer camp and eating, here's a charity that combines all three. Every Wednesday from now through July, all of the area Clyde's locations plus the Old Ebbitt Grill will feature a special item on their menus. If you order it, a portion of the proceeds goes to the Washington Post's Send a Kid To Camp campaign. [EaterWire]
